I consider sending relevant emails to pages they were looking at (in stead of sending generic emails)
If you can properly segment your email audience, it would make sense, but in the end it's all about KETO which is niched down already. I mean, depending on how many sub-categories you would segment into, you might find yourself trying to target way too many smaller audiences. If we are talking about thousands of prospects in every sub-category, then go for it, but if the numbers are smaller the extra work likely won't justify the benefits.
